Ganga Expressway Sets Two World Records in 24-Hour Construction Feat

The Uttar Pradesh project achieved certification for record-breaking road paving and crash barrier installation, with completion now projected for November.

Overview

  • Construction teams laid 34.24 lane kilometres of bituminous concrete and installed 10 kilometres of crash barriers in just 24 hours between Hardoi and Unnao districts.
  • The achievement has been officially certified by the Golden Book of World Records, Asia Book of Records, and India Book of Records.
  • The work was executed by UPEIDA in collaboration with Adani Road and Transport Limited and Patel Infrastructure Limited.
  • The expressway spans 594 kilometres, connecting 12 districts from Meerut to Prayagraj, with a proposed extension to Ballia, making it India's longest state-owned expressway.
  • Initially targeting a pre-Maha Kumbh 2025 completion, the project is now expected to be finished by November 2025.
